The melt in your mouth chocolate factory is a rectangular building. The dostance across the front of the store is 294 feet. The distance from the front to the back is one third of this distance. If the owners paint a sign all the way around the outside of the factory, how many feet long will the sign be?

To find the total length of the sign, we need to calculate the perimeter of the rectangular building.

Given:
- The distance across the front of the store is 294 feet.
- The distance from the front to the back is one third (1/3) of the distance across the front.

We can start by finding the distance from the front to the back of the store:

Distance from front to back = 1/3 * distance across the front
= 1/3 * 294
= 98 feet

Now, let's calculate the perimeter of the rectangular building, which is the total length of the sign:

Perimeter = 2 * (distance across the front + distance from front to back)
= 2 * (294 + 98)
= 2 * 392
= 784 feet

Therefore, the sign will be 784 feet long.
